
Dubai is set to build a tower higher than the
existing record-braaking skyscraper, the Burj
Khalifa, which is presently the world's tallest
building. Construction for the new tower which
is to be known as The Tower at Dubai Creek,
will start at the end of June this year and is
hoped to be finished before Dubai hosts the
World Expo in 2020. The tower is said to cost
around $1 billion and will be a notch taller than
Burj Khalifa which opened in January 2010 and
stands at 828 meters high.
